Answer: Mansa Musa lived from (1312 – 1337) mansa of the Mali Empire, which reached its territorial peak during his reign. Musa is known for his wealth, and has erroneously been called the wealthiest person in history.

At the time of Musa's ascension to the throne, Mali in large part consisted of the territory of the former Ghana Empire, which Mali had conquered. The Mali Empire consisted of land that is now part of Guinea, Senegal, Mauritania, The Gambia, and the modern state of Mali.

Musa went on hajj to Mecca in 1324, traveling with an enormous entourage and a vast supply of gold. En route, he spent time in Cairo, where his lavish gift-giving is said to have noticeably affected the value of gold in Egypt and garnered the attention of the wider Muslim world.

Musa expanded the borders of the Mali Empire, in particular incorporating the cities of Gao and Timbuktu into its territory. He sought closer ties with the rest of the Muslim world, particularly the Mamluk and Marinid Sultanates. He recruited scholars from the wider Muslim world to travel to Mali, such as the Andalusian poet Abu Ishaq al-Sahili, and helped establish Timbuktu as a center of Islamic learning. His reign is associated with numerous construction projects, including part of Djinguereber Mosque in Timbuktu. Musa's reign is often regarded as the zenith of Mali's power and prestige.

The governor of Arkansas whose name was Orval Faubus first forbade the unification of Central High School in the city of Little Rock, Arkansas.

Nine Black Americans enrolling in Little Rock Central High School in the year 1957 made formed the group known as "The Little Rock Nine." The Little Rock Crisis, which was precipitated by the pupils' enrollment, happened after Orval Faubus, the governor of Arkansas, first forbade them from enrolling in the racially segregated school. Following President Dwight D. Eisenhower's involvement, they went. The Arkansas Guard was instructed by Governor Orval Faubus to keep African American pupils from registering at Central High School. The students of Central High were all white. The 1954 Brown v. Topeka ruling by the Supreme Court outlawed segregation in public schools. This choice was defied by Governor Faubus. He also disregarded a 1955 decision. The 1955 ruling mandated that desegregation in public schools take place as quickly as possible.

The Beat movement, also known as the Beat Generation, was a social and literary movement in the United States that started in the 1950s. It was centered in the bohemian artist communities of North Beach in San Francisco, Venice West in Los Angeles, and Greenwich Village in New York City. By adopting a dress code, manners, and "hip" vocabulary borrowed from jazz musicians, its adherents, who self-described as "beat" (originally meaning "weary" but later also connoting a musical sense, a "beatific" spirituality, and other meanings), expressed their alienation from conventional, or "square," society. Through the increased sensory awareness that could be brought on by drugs, jazz, sex, or the practices of Zen Buddhism, they advocated for personal release, purification, and illumination. The Beats and those who supported them felt that modern society's lack of purpose and joy was sufficient justification for both withdrawal and protest. Beat poets wanted poetry to be an authentic expression of their own lived experiences. In Beat hotspots like San Francisco's Coexistence Bagel Shop and Lawrence Ferlinghetti's City Lights bookstore, they read their works, sometimes to progressive jazz accompaniment. In an effort to free poetry from academic pretension, the verse was frequently chaotic, abundant in profanities, and made open references to sex.

The Iranian Revolution in 1979 brought significant changes to the country, including the weakening of its armed forces. The new Islamic government initiated a purge of military officers. In 1980, Iraq, led by Saddam Hussein, launched a surprise invasion of Iran, citing territorial disputes over the border region of Khuzestan.

Iraqi forces quickly captured the Iranian city of Khorramshahr in the early stages of the war. However, Iran eventually managed to push back and recapture the city after a year-long siege, in what was considered a significant victory for the Iranian military. After years of fighting and hundreds of thousands of casualties, the war ended in 1988 with a ceasefire and a return to pre-war borders.

The Treaty of Versailles was a peace treaty signed on June 28, 1919, which officially ended World War I between the Allied and Central powers.

The treaty placed full responsibility for the war on Germany and imposed severe financial penalties and territorial losses on the country.

It is considered important because it played a crucial role in setting the stage for World War II by creating economic and political instability in Europe, and also for shaping the modern international system through the establishment of the League of Nations.

Constitution of India being supreme law of the land, provides inarguably, the division of power between Union and State. The power-sharing arrangement as provided under the Constitution lays down that the State government are not subordinate to the Central Government, i.e., State Government are given autonomy. So in order to make any changes in this power-sharing arrangement, the Constitution has to go through the amendment process, which in the case of Constitution is complicated.
For e.g., Those provisions which relate to the federal structure of the polity, it can be amended by a special majority and also with the ratification ( consent) of half of the state legislatures by a simple majority.

Both speeches were delivered in the mid-1960s when the Civil Rights Movement was at its peak in the United States While both speeches were given during the same era, the speakers had different approaches to achieving their goals.

Martin Luther King Jr.'s "I Have Been to the Mountaintop" speech and Malcolm X's "The Ballot or the Bullet" speech can be compared and contrasted as follows:

Comparisons:

Both speeches were delivered to African American audiences, and both speakers advocated for the rights and empowerment of African Americans. Both speeches were given as calls to action, urging their listeners to become more active in the fight for civil rights. Both speakers used rhetorical devices, such as repetition, to emphasize their points and to create an emotional impact on their audiences.

Contrasts:

Martin Luther King Jr. emphasized nonviolent resistance, urging his listeners to use peaceful means to achieve their goals. Malcolm X, on the other hand, advocated for more radical measures, including self-defense and armed resistance if necessary. King's speech was given just days before his assassination and had a more religious tone, while Malcolm X's speech was given during a time of political unrest and had a more confrontational tone. Malcolm X's speech focused more on political empowerment, while King's speech focused more on the broader goals of achieving racial equality and justice.
